Fresh Start Clubhouse Lays Off Employees

The coronavirus crisis has caused layoffs at an organization in Ann Arbor that offers mental health services.  WEMU's Jorge Avellan has the details.

Six full-time staff members and a part-time employee have been laid-off at the Fresh Start Clubhouse.  The facility had recently transitioned to video conferences and phone calls to serve its nearly 110 members.  But Director Summer Berman says they're no longer being reimbursed by Medicaid because their service format changed.

"We're providing a lot of one-to-one outreach via variety of different platforms. We've been preparing meals and delivering them to people"

Berman is the only employee still on the payroll, and she's trying to offer services to as many clubhouse members as possible.  She's reached out to the Michigan Department of Health and Human Services for help.
